Table 5-3. GPS-S Design, Geometry, Connection, <strong>and</strong> Observing Criteria(continued)e. Location Feasibility <strong>and</strong> Field Reconnaissance. A good advance reconnaissance of all markswithin the project is crucial to the expedient <strong>and</strong> successful completion of a GPS-S. The sitereconnaissance should be completed before the survey is started. The surveyor should also prepare a sitesketch <strong>and</strong> a brief description on how to reach the point since the individual performing the sitereconnaissance may not be the same surveyor that returns to the station. The azimuths <strong>and</strong> verticalangles should be determined using a compass <strong>and</strong> inclinometer <strong>and</strong> recorded by the individualperforming the site reconnaissance.
